Pocket PC Phone: New Device by O2, O2 XDA Zinc Minimize
O2_XDA_ZINC_FRONT_SMALL.jpgA new Windows Mobile manufactured by ASUSTek will be made available by O2 as the O2 XDA Zinc. The design of this pocket pc is similar to HTC TyTN. It has a sliding QWERTY keyboard and 3G capabilities(WCDMA2100). The O2 XDA Zinc will be lighter (165g ) than the HTC TyTN (176g). Its size will be 3mm shorter in length than the TyTN with Width and Depth almost the same (Zinc Dimensions: 109 x 58 x 22.6 mm ). The O2 XDA Zinc will have an Intel PXA 270 processor at 520 MHZ (the TyTN runs Samsung SC3244A at 400 MHZ), 128 MB ROM and 64 MB RAM. For connectivity it will be GSM Tri-Band and will have built-in Wi-FI, bluetooth and Infrared. For memory expansion the O2 XDA Zinc will have a Mini SD Slot while the TyTN has a micro SD. The device will also carry a 2.0 Mega Pixel CMOS camera with Auto-Focus and built-in flash. The released date is expected to be January 2007. GIGABYTE g-smart i200

gsmart_i200Small.jpgGigabyte revealed a new g-smart i series pocket pc phone, the gsmart i-200.The device will be the first one, announced to date, that will carry the new version of Windows Mobile (codename:Crossbow). This of course will happen if the new version of Windows Mobile is released before the i200's launch. The scheduled launch of i200 is Q1,2007. The i200 will be equipped with built-in DVB-H receiver (and maybe a DVB-T). Other known specifications of the g-smart i200 pocket pc phone are  the 2.7 inch VGA Display (touch screen), 512 MB memory and USB 2.0 port. Read More…

GIGAGYTE g-smart i300

g-smart_i300Small.jpgGigabyte will release soon the g-smart i300. The device will run Windows Mobile 5.0 Phone Edition (Tri-Band) and will have GPS receiver build in (SiRFSTAR III).It will also have bluetooth and wi-fi (802.11g). The QVGA screen is 2.4 inch, and in terms of memory it will have 64MB RAM,256 ROM and a mini SD expansion slot. The g-smart i300 processor will be an Intel XScale PXA272 at 416 MHz. The device will also have a 2 mega pixel camera (with Macro Mode) and an FM Radio. Read More...

 

SAMSUNG SGH-i760

samsungSG-i760Small.jpgSamsung SGH-i760 is a new pocket pc mobile from Samsung. The device will be running Windows Mobile 5.0. The processor is an Intel at 520 MHZ. The size of the device is 154 x 57 x 19mm and weighs 119g. It also has a slide-out QWERTY keyboard, a 2 megapixel camera,WI-FI, Bluetooth, supports GSM/GPRS/EDGE/UMTS/HSDPA. The display is a QVGA with 240X320 resolution. Read More...

  
Pocket PC SmartPhone: O2 XDA Graphite Minimize
O2_GRAPHITE_SMALL.jpgThe O2 XDA Graphite is a new candy bar smartphone manufactured by ASUSTek and branded by O2. The device lacks buit-in Wi-Fi but supports bluetooth v2.0. In terms of connectivity it is Tri-Band GSM with support for UMTS (3GPP Band I). The O2 XDA Graphite runs Windows Mobile 5.0. Comparing the O2 XDA Graphite with a look alike phone, the HTC S310 you can say that the O2 XDA Graphite will have a faster processor (Intel PXA270 416 MHZ ), more ROM (128MB) and a bigger screen (2.2 inch). HTC has launched their first device under their name the TyTN until now HTC had manufactured devices for other companies like imate,T-Mobile, orange and so on. TyTN is a very interesting device and the first useable 3G windows mobile device the first one was HTC Universal (imate jasjar…) but due its size and weight was far from being a useable everyday phone. TyTN shares the same design concept as imate kjam first appear about a year ago but other than looks the rest of the hardware is dramatically changed.

The i-Mate Smartflip or otherwise known as QTEK 8500 windows mobile smartphone, is a radical new admission into the smart phone market, offering a truly compact and light-weight clamshell design. The Smartflip is running the Windows Mobile 5 operating system.
This device gave an end to the impression that smaprtphones and pocket pc mobile phones running Microsoft’s operating system should be large, heavy and bulky. The smartlip measures only 98.5 x 51.4 x 15.8 mm and weights 99g.

Feature Comparison: Moto Q, SGH-i320, ipaq hw6915

The Motorola Moto Q, the Samsung SGH-i320 and the HP IPAQ hw6915 share a common design; they all have a QWERTY keyboard on the front. They all run Windows Mobile 5.0, and carry a 1.3 megapixel camera. The Motorola Moto Q and the Samsung SGH-i320 are smartphones (no touch panel) while the HP IPAQ hw6915 is a pocket pc phone. From these three popular phones the smallest device is the Samsung SGH-i320, the nicest looking device is the Motorola Moto Q and the device with the most connectivity options is the HP IPAQ hw6915.
